Top Platforms Offering a German Online Course Free
Several reputable platforms provide free German courses online, each with unique features catering to different learning preferences. Below are some top choices:
1. Duolingo
Duolingo is a popular language app known for its gamified approach, making learning fun and addictive. It covers vocabulary, grammar, and pronunciation through short lessons and daily goals.
- Pros: User-friendly interface, mobile accessibility, progress tracking
- Cons: Limited in-depth grammar explanations
2. Deutsche Welle (DW)
DW offers comprehensive free courses tailored for various levels, including “Nicos Weg,” an interactive video series designed for beginners to intermediate learners.
- Pros: High-quality content, cultural insights, downloadable materials
- Cons: Less gamification, requires self-motivation
3. Lingoda Free Trial
While Lingoda is primarily a paid service, it offers a free trial that includes live classes with native teachers, perfect for testing structured online learning.
- Pros: Live interaction, structured lessons
- Cons: Limited free access, requires scheduling
4. Memrise
Memrise combines vocabulary learning with real-life videos of native speakers, helping learners grasp everyday conversational German.
- Pros: Engaging content, spaced repetition system
- Cons: Some advanced features require payment
